Problem with Inspiron E1505 WON'T START - NEED HELP
This morning I woke up and saw liquid around my laptop, lifted it up and found a big puddle that smelled like rum and I obviously don't remember making it. Completely dried off the desk and wiped off the bottom of the laptop. Everything else, such as the keyboard, area around it, and the screen felt completely dry. Unplugged it and took out the battery. Came back hours later, turned it on, and it was working just fine until it suddenly shut off. Everytime after that, it shut off (or froze up) sooner and sooner until now it hardly powers on at all. It just turns on with the screen completely blank and flashes the caps lock and battery lights and spins the hard drive until powering off after less than a minute. Optical drive won't open. I assume the hard drive's okay, but is the rest of the system salvageable in any immediate way? I don't have Complete Care coverage or money to get it repaired professionally at the moment.
